Abstract:
   Enterprise networks provide a secured data communications
   infrastructure built for the purpose of information sharing and
   increased productivity for end users within the organization.
   Enterprise networks are often organized as private Internets unto
   themselves that connect to the global Internet either not at all or
   via firewalls, proxies, and/or other network securing devices.  This
   document discusses an AERO enterprise network profile that outlines
   new and more flexible methods for connecting, tracking and managing
   mobile organizational assets.
